Wizkid, Asake, and Tyla to Headline Afro Nation Portugal 2026 Festival

Global Afrobeats stars Wizkid and Asake are set to headline the highly anticipated Afro Nation Portugal 2026 festival, with South African music sensation Tyla joining them at the top of the star-studded lineup. The festival, known for bringing together the best of African music in one of Europe’s most scenic destinations, will take place over three days from July 3 to July 5, 2026, at Praia da Rocha in the Algarve region of Portugal.


The announcement of the headliners has already generated excitement among fans worldwide, with many eagerly anticipating the opportunity to see the biggest names in Afrobeats and African pop performing live. Wizkid, one of the most influential global Afrobeats artists, is expected to deliver a dynamic set filled with his chart-topping hits, while Asake, who has rapidly risen to prominence in recent years, is poised to energize the crowd with his infectious blend of street-hop and Afrobeat rhythms. Tyla, whose viral hit tracks have captured audiences across the globe, will bring her distinctive South African sound to the festival stage, adding further diversity to the musical offerings.


In addition to the headliners, the festival’s 2026 edition will feature a range of other prominent performers, including Nigerian music icon Olamide, hitmaker and producer Young Jonn, rising star Darkoo, and American rapper Gunna, who will appear as a special guest. The lineup reflects Afro Nation Portugal’s commitment to showcasing both established and emerging talent, offering festivalgoers a unique opportunity to experience a wide spectrum of African music.


Organizers revealed the lineup following the overwhelming success of the 2025 edition, which drew music lovers from across the world and solidified Afro Nation Portugal’s reputation as one of the premier summer destinations for African music enthusiasts.
